  • Patent number: 6312413
    Abstract: A cylinder ampoule (1) having a first end sealed by a closure through which an injection unit can communicate with a medicament in the ampoule and a second end closed by a piston (3) which can be forced into the ampoule (1) to press out a dose of a medicament stored in the ampoule between the closure and the piston (3) through said injection unit, which cylinder ampoule (1) has a non-circular inner cross section and which piston (3) has a non-circular cross section corresponding to the inner cross section of the ampoule (1). A piston rod (4) has a pressure foot (5) which has a cross section corresponding to the inner cross section of the ampoule (1) and is non-rotatably connected to the piston rod (4).

  • Patent number: 6248090
    Abstract: A syringe having a dose setting mechanism, a button which can be operated to inject a set dose, a switch operated at a time between the start and completion of injection, and an electronic presentation of parameters such as the size of a set dose and the size of the last dose administered. The syringe also has a stop watch which is reset and started responsive to operation of the switch. The electronic presentation includes an indication of the number of hours elapsed from the activation of the switch, and may also include, for a predetermined period initially following the activation of the switch, a presentation of the number of seconds elapsed. The latter presentation can provide a visual indication to the patient of the length of time, after the injection button has been actuated to inject the dose, that the needle should remain inserted in the skin.

  • Patent number: 6010485
    Abstract: The present invention relates to a drug delivery system, comprising a reservoir from which set doses are apportioned, a dose setting mechanism by which the relative position of two elements is changed by a distance proportional to a set dose, and a push button by activation of which an element is moved a distance corresponding to the distance proportional to the set dose, further comprises a working cylinder having an open end into which a plunger fits, and a closed end at which an inlet and an outlet port connect the space beneath the plunger with an inlet communicating with the reservoir and an outlet communicating with a drug delivery member, respectively. Valves means at the inlet and outlet control the passages from the reservoir to the working cylinder and from the working cylinder to the drug delivery member, respectively. The cylinder with the plunger, and the injection member are independently exchangeable, disposable parts.

  • Patent number: 5984894
    Abstract: An infuser for infusing a liquid from a reservoir, comprising a durable part (1,2,3) forming a housing and a disposable part (4) containing the liquid reservoir and an energy reservoir for energizing the pumping function. The infuser, further, contains in its disposable part (4) all liquid-contacting elements of the device, and the disposable part (4) and the durable part (1,2,3) are provided with mating coupling means (10,11).A controlling unit in an electronic compartment (3) of the durable part (1,2,3) has a socket (12) into which a plug (13) may be inserted, the plug (13) contains a ROM carrying information defining infusion data. The plug (13) has a transparent sheet (14) covering a display (8) of the durable part when the plug (13) is inserted in the socket (12). The sheet (14) carries a graphic representation of the information in the ROM to be seen in relation to information displayed on the display (8).

  • Patent number: 5954689
    Abstract: An injector comprising a changeable cylinder ampoule (2) containing medicine for a number of injections into which ampoule a piston (4) is pressed by a piston rod (9) driven by a drive mechanism to dispense a dose of medicine through a nozzle (5) as a high speed jet which penetrates the skin. The injector comprises a distal part (1) accommodating the cylinder ampoule (2) and a proximal part (8) containing the drive mechanism and the piston rod (9) which can be advanced a set distance by the drive mechanism when released, the distal and the proximal parts being provided with mutually engaging threads so that one of these parts can successively be screwed into the other to set a dose to be delivered by the device.

  • Patent number: 5928201
    Abstract: The present invention relates to a drug delivery device wherein a dose to be apportioned from a cartridge is set by changing the relative position of co-operating dose setting elements (3, 5) and is injected by pressing a button (5) until this button abuts a stop (6). By operation of count up (7) or count down (8) buttons the dose is set and read into an electronic circuit (9) comprising a microprocessor and the dose setting movement of the dose setting elements relative to each other is performed by a motor (11) controlled by the circuit in accordance with the read in dose. The set dose is shown on a display (10). The motor (11) is further controlled to perform certain movements of the piston rod (3) so as retraction of this rod when a cartridge (1) is going to be changed an advancing of the piston rod to abutment with the piston (2) after the cartridge has been changed and further to advance this piston to expel air from the cartridge.
